EL SALVADOR

ShalomFamily Medical Center SANTIAGO TEXACUANGOS, EL SALVADOR

I n partnership with the El Salvador Ministry of Health, Universidad Evangélica de El Salvador (UEES) and the AMILAT (Asociación Amigos por Latinoamérica) Foundation, VCOM assists with the operation of the Shalom Family Medical Center. This clinic, located in an impoverished Santiago Texacuangos community near San Salvador, offers prenatal, pediatric, emergency and primary care services. Shalom Family Medical Center also provides care to a nearby school and orphanage, both operated by AMILAT. The clinic, which serves up to 70 patients per day, contains a laboratory and a pharmacy. Recently added laboratory equipment provides immediate results for patient consultations. The clinic also added a second ambulance and a complete blood count (CBC) machine, with additional funding secured for a backup generator and cervical cancer prevention equipment. The Universidad Evangelica de El Salvador (UEES), provides more than 40 medical students who collaborate and serve as interpreters during VCOM medical trips. Additionally, students from UEES and VCOM learn together through the Global Seminar Program, an annual course that encourages the sharing of knowledge between countries about global health challenges.

Since opening this VCOM-affiliated clinic in 2016, basic primary care and pediatrics services have rapidly expanded. 2019 Clinic enhancements include: • Complete Blood Count (CBC) and related equipment that provide lab results for immediate patient care • A fully implemented Clinical Rotation Evaluation and Documentation Organizer (CREDO) for electronic record reporting • A second ambulance to provide service to government health clinic in exchange for childhood vaccination services at VCOM-affiliated clinic • Added dental services with a full-time dentist and dental assistant

• A nutritionist added to the staff roster

• Colposcopy and cryotherapy equipment for cervical cancer prevention program

• A backup generator installed for the Clinic

• A trip for eight members of Shalom medical staff to visit the Baxter Clinic (page 61) to collaborate and exchange ideas
